What is a Landslide?
Landslide is the movement of soil, rock, or other surface materials down slopes due to gravity. This phenomenon can occur slowly or rapidly and may cause damage to the environment. Steep slopes facilitate the sliding of soil and rocks under the influence of gravity.

Factors Triggering Landslides
Landslides can occur due to loose or water-saturated soil, heavy rainfall, snow and ice melt, earthquakes and tremors, loss of vegetation, and human activities. These factors can initiate sliding individually or in combination.
Formation of Landslides
The structure of the soil, slope angle, and water accumulation determine the speed of sliding. Snow and ice melt soften the soil and facilitate movement. Earthquakes and tremors can displace soil. Loss of vegetation and human activities disrupt the balance of slopes.
Soil Landslide
A soil landslide is the slow or rapid sliding of the upper soil layer. Agricultural fields and gardens are commonly affected by this type.

Rock Landslide
In a rock landslide, large fragments of rock break away from the slope and fall rapidly downward. These pose a serious threat to roads and structures.

Mudflow
Mudflows occur when soil and rocks mix with water and flow rapidly downhill. They can destroy homes, roads, and agricultural land.
Snow Avalanche (Slushflow)
Snow masses slide rapidly down mountain slopes. Such landslides create hazards for roads and villages.

Rockfall
Small rocks or rock fragments detach from steep slopes. These pose a risk to roads and homes.
Subsidence Landslide
The upper layer collapses due to voids forming in the underlying soil layers. This can threaten buildings and roads.
Damage Caused by Landslides
Landslides pose serious threats to homes, buildings, roads, agricultural land, and infrastructure. Forests, animal habitats, and river flows can also be affected. Major landslides can result in loss of life and property and make life difficult in affected areas.

What Happens During a Landslide and How Should One Respond?
It is essential to move to a safe location during a landslide. People inside buildings should stay away from windows and remain in safer areas. Those outdoors should head toward higher, stable ground.
Since large rocks and mud masses move rapidly downhill, running downward is dangerous. In such situations, attention should be paid to guidance from elders or teachers.
After a landslide ends, it is necessary to avoid approaching damaged areas. Safety is ensured once rescue teams arrive. Staying calm and carefully observing the surroundings are among the factors that can save lives during a landslide.
Landslide Prevention and Safety
Landslide risks on steep slopes can be identified in advance. Planting trees and vegetation reduces soil sliding. Drainage of rainwater can help reduce soil saturation.
Homes and buildings should be constructed in safe areas. Early warning systems help prevent loss of life and property by alerting people in advance when landslide risks arise.
